If I had this soup before every meal, I’d be a happy camper. I did substitute celery for parsnips, simply because I had celery in my fridge and no parsnips. I also used 2 tbsp of butter and 2 tbsp of olive oil instead of the 4 tbsp of butter that the recipe calls for. That’s just my personal preference. Here is the recipe in the original form:

Beef and Red Wine Broth (Serves 6):

4 tbsp unsalted butter

1 and 1/2c chopped yellow onions

2 carrots, peeled and chopped

1 parsnip, peeled and chopped

8 to 10 garlic cloves, peeled and chopped

3/4 c chopped parsley

5 c beef stock (or combination beef and chicken stock)

1 c dry red wine

salt and pepper to taste

1 cup small pasta (I used orzo)

Grated Parmesan-Reggiano cheese for garnish (optional, but highly recommended!)

Melt butter in large heavy pot over low heat. Add the onions, carrots, parsnip and chopped garlic. Cook, covered, until all vegetables are tender (approx. 25 min). Add chopped parsely, beef stock and wine. Season with salt and pepper. Bring to a boil over medium heat, reduce heat and let simmer (partially covered) for 20 minutes. Bring quart of salted water to a boil and add in pasta. Cook until pasta is tender. Drain pasta and reserve. Pour soup through a strainer and discard solids. Return broth to the soup pot, add cooked pasta and simmer (covered) for 10 minutes. Serve and enjoy!
